Growing 5G and IoT Adoption
Rapid deployment of 5G networks and increasing use of IoT devices are significantly boosting demand for RF MEMS in wireless communication.
Miniaturization of Electronic Components
The trend toward smaller, lighter, and more power-efficient electronic devices is driving innovations in RF MEMS technology.
Increasing Use in Automotive Applications
RF MEMS are being increasingly integrated into automotive radar and communication systems, enhancing safety and connectivity.
Integration with AI and Edge Computing
Advancements in AI and edge computing are pushing the need for high-performance MEMS devices in smart sensors and connected devices.
Rising Demand in Consumer Electronics
Smartphones, tablets, and wearables are incorporating RF MEMS for better signal quality and lower power consumption.

Expansion of 5G Infrastructure
The global rollout of 5G networks is driving the demand for RF MEMS components, especially in antennas, filters, and switches.
High Demand in Consumer Electronics
Increasing use of smartphones, tablets, and smartwatches is boosting the integration of RF MEMS due to their compact size and efficiency.
Technological Advancements in MEMS Design
Innovations in fabrication and processing technologies are making RF MEMS more reliable and cost-effective for mass production.
Complexity in Manufacturing
The intricate fabrication process of RF MEMS devices can result in higher production costs and quality control issues.
Limited Standardization
Lack of universal standards across the RF MEMS industry can hinder interoperability and scalability.
Reliability Concerns
Environmental factors and mechanical stress may affect the performance and longevity of RF MEMS in harsh conditions.
Emerging Markets and Smart Cities
Developing regions investing in telecommunications and smart city projects present growth avenues for RF MEMS applications.
Satellite Communication Expansion
The rise in satellite-based services and low Earth orbit (LEO) constellations offers new opportunities for RF MEMS deployment.
Integration in Autonomous Vehicles
RF MEMS play a crucial role in vehicle-to-vehicle (V2V) and vehicle-to-everything (V2X) communications, driving future demand.
High R&D Investment Requirements
Companies must invest heavily in research to keep up with the fast-paced advancements in RF MEMS technology.
Competition from Alternative Technologies
Other RF solutions like GaN or CMOS-based components may pose challenges to MEMS adoption in some applications.
Thermal and Mechanical Stress Management
Maintaining performance in extreme temperature and mechanical environments remains a key challenge for RF MEMS design.
